Skip to content

👷 Update python versions to test#69

Draft
evaline-ju wants to merge 7 commits intoIBM:mainfrom
evaline-ju:python-updates
Draft

👷 Update python versions to test#69
evaline-ju wants to merge 7 commits intoIBM:mainfrom
evaline-ju:python-updates

Conversation

@evaline-ju
Copy link
Copy Markdown
Member

@evaline-ju evaline-ju commented Feb 11, 2025

  • Replace python3.7 with 3.12
  • The most recent grpcio and grpcio-tools specify protobuf 5+, so technically these should be pinned lower until protobuf 5+ is allowed
  • descriptor.syntax generates a RuntimeWarning on deprecation ref https://github.com/protocolbuffers/protobuf/commit/fd40c87befa92c1b944ae5fbd42bafe41003ad4e#diff-aa61a5e2485e2d26eba7eb512781762f9530c01e172abe4916342e4d6e345b9a which causes a SystemError for tests, but ignoring this will cause failure in generating file descriptors

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Signed-off-by: Evaline Ju <69598118+evaline-ju@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ant